Slå sandkassetilstand til eller fra for at deaktivere makroer

Vigtigt: Denne artikel er maskinoversat. Se ansvarsfraskrivelsen. Du kan finde den engelske version af denne artikel her til din orientering.

I denne artikel beskrives det, hvordan du kan bruge Access-sikkerhedsfunktionen sandkassetilstand. I sandkassetilstand blokerer Access for "usikre" udtryk: alle de udtryk, der bruger funktioner eller egenskaber, som kan blive brugt at ondsindede brugere til at få adgang til drev, filer eller andre ressourcer, som de ikke har godkendelse til at bruge. Det kan f.eks. være funktioner som Kill og Shell, der kan bruges til at beskadige data og filer på en computer, og som derfor blokeres i sandkassetilstand.

Bemærk:  Dette emne omhandler ikke Access-apps eller webdatabaser, og det omhandler ikke andre sikkerhedsfunktioner i Access. Du kan finde flere oplysninger i afsnittet Se også i denne artikel.

I denne artikel

Oversigt

Deaktivere sandkassetilstand (køre usikre udtryk)

Oversigt

Sandkassetilstand er en sikkerhedsfunktion, der forhindrer Access i at køre bestemte udtryk, der kan være usikre. Disse usikre udtryk blokeres, uanset om der er tillid til databasen, og dens indhold er aktiveret.

Sådan indstilles sandkassetilstand

Du skal bruge en nøgle i registreringsdatabasen til at angive, om Access skal køre i sandkassetilstand. Sandkassetilstand er som standard aktiveret – værdien af nøglen i registreringsdatabasen er indstillet til at aktivere sandkassetilstand, når Access installeres på en computer. Hvis du vil tillade, at alle undtagelser køres, kan du ændre værdien af nøglen i registreringsdatabasen for at deaktivere sandkassetilstand.

Databaser, der er tillid til

Uanset om sandkassetilstand er aktiveret i registreringsdatabasen, vil Access ikke tillade, at potentielt usikre udtryk køres, medmindre databasefilen enten findes på en placering, der er tillid til, eller at den har et gyldigt sikkerhedscertifikat. Hvis der ikke er tillid til en database, bruger Access sandkassetilstand.

Nedenstående tegning viser den beslutningsproces, Access følger, når der forekommer et usikkert udtryk.

Beslutningsproces for sandkassetilstand

Hvis du ikke har erfaring med registreringsdatabasen, eller hvis du ikke føler dig tryg ved selv at ændre nøgler i registreringsdatabasen, skal du bede om hjælp hos en person, der har erfaring og er fortrolig med at ændre registreringsdatabasen. Du skal have administratorrettigheder til denne computer for at ændre værdier i registreringsdatabasen.

Toppen af siden

Deaktivere sandkassetilstand (køre usikre udtryk)

I nogle situationer kan du deaktivere sandkassetilstand ved at ændre værdien af en registreringsdatabasenøgle.

Bemærk:  Det er ikke alle installationer af Access, der indeholder registreringsdatabasenøglen SandBoxMode, som der refereres til herunder. Hvis du ikke kan finde registreringsdatabasenøglen, kan det ikke anbefales, at du tilføjer den, da det kan give problemer i forhold til Office-opdateringer.

Advarsel      Hvis du redigerer noget forkert i registreringsdatabasen, kan det beskadige operativsystemet i en sådan grad, at du er nødt til at geninstallere det. Microsoft kan ikke garantere, at de problemer, der opstår som følge af forkert redigering af registreringsdatabasen, kan løses. Før du redigerer registreringsdatabasen, skal du sikkerhedskopiere værdifulde data. Se i Microsoft Windows Hjælp for at få de seneste oplysninger om, hvordan du bruger og beskytter registreringsdatabasen.

Ændre nøglen i registreringsdatabasen

Vigtigt: Ved at benytte nedenstående fremgangsmåde kan du tillade, at alle brugere på computeren kan køre usikre udtryk i alle forekomster af Access.

  1. Luk alle forekomster af Access, der kører på den computer, hvor du vil deaktivere sandkassetilstand.

  2. Tryk på Windows-tasten, skriv Kør, og tryk på Enter.

  3. Skriv regedit i boksen Åbn, og tryk derefter på Enter.

    Registreringseditor startes.

  4. Udvid mappen HKEY_LOCAL_MACHINE, og gå til følgende nøgle i registreringsdatabasen:

    \Software\Microsoft\Office\15.0\Access Connectivity Engine\Engines

  5. Dobbeltklik på SandBoxMode under Navn i højre rude af Registreringseditor, hvis den findes. Hvis du ikke kan finde registreringsdatabasenøglen SandBoxMode, kan det ikke anbefales, at du tilføjer den, da det kan give problemer i forhold til Office-opdateringer.

    Dialogboksen Rediger DWORD-værdi vises.

  6. Skift værdien i feltet Værdidata fra 3 til 2, og klik derefter på OK.

  7. Luk Registreringseditor.

Vigtigt: Husk, at hvis du ikke først aktiverer indholdet i databasen, deaktiverer Access alle usikre udtryk, uanset om du ændrer denne indstilling i registreringsdatabasen.

Du kan angive værdien i registreringsdatabasen til følgende værdier, hvor 0 (nul) er den mest omfattende, og 3 er den mindst omfattende.

Indstilling

Beskrivelse

0

Sandkassetilstand er deaktiveret til enhver tid.

1

Sandkassetilstand bruges til Access, men ikke til ikke-Access-programmer.

2

Sandkassetilstand bruges til ikke-Access-programmer, men ikke til Access.

3

Sandkassetilstand bruges til enhver tid. Dette er den standardværdi, der angives, når du installerer Access.

Toppen af siden

Bemærk: Ansvarsfraskrivelse for maskinoversættelse: Denne artikel er blevet oversat af et computersystem uden menneskelig indgriben. Microsoft tilbyder disse maskinoversættelse for at hjælpe ikke-engelsktalende brugere til at kunne nyde indhold om Microsofts produkter, tjenester og teknologier. Da artiklen er maskinoversat, kan den indeholde forkerte ord eller syntaks- eller grammatikfejl.

Del Facebook Facebook Twitter Twitter Mail Mail

Var disse oplysninger nyttige?

Fantastisk! Har du mere feedback?

Hvordan kan vi forbedre det?

Tak for din feedback!

×